How does the market cap of MCOIN (MCOIN) coin compare to other meme coins?
Understanding Market Capitalization in Cryptocurrency:
Market capitalization (market cap) is a crucial metric used to gauge the size and value of a cryptocurrency within the overall cryptocurrency market. It is calculated by multiplying the current market price of a coin by the total number of coins in circulation. Market cap provides insights into the popularity, adoption rate, and overall market sentiment surrounding a particular cryptocurrency.
Factors Influencing Market Cap:
The market cap of a meme coin, including MCOIN, is influenced by a variety of factors, including:
- Supply and demand: The availability of the coin and its demand in the market significantly impact its price and market cap.
- Community and hype: The size and enthusiasm of the community surrounding a meme coin can drive its market value and cap.
- Media coverage and social media: Favorable media attention and strong social media presence can enhance the coin's visibility and appeal.
- Scarcity and uniqueness: Limited supply or unique features can contribute to higher market cap for meme coins.
- Market sentiment and trends: Overall market conditions and trends can affect the price and market cap of all cryptocurrencies, including meme coins.

FAQs:
- What is the highest market cap for a meme coin?
Dogecoin (DOGE) currently holds the highest market cap among meme coins, hovering around $11.5 billion as of March 8, 2023. - What factors influence a meme coin's market cap?
Factors such as supply and demand, community support, media attention, scarcity, and market sentiment play a role in determining the market cap of a meme coin. - Is it likely that MCOIN's market cap will grow?
The potential growth of MCOIN's market cap depends on various factors, including the project's development progress, community engagement, and overall market conditions. - How do meme coins differ from ordinary cryptocurrencies?
Meme coins are often characterized by a strong community focus, a humorous or lighthearted theme, and a lower market cap compared to established cryptocurrencies. - What are the risks associated with investing in meme coins?
Meme coins may exhibit significant price volatility and are susceptible to hype and manipulation, leading to potential financial risks for investors.
